Garnier Mythic Olive Collection.*

Dry skin is becoming the bane of my existence. I've never really suffered from dry skin before, but recently I can't seem to get rid of it, so I was excited to try out the Mythic Olive Ultimate blends collection from Garnier which was kindly sent to me by BzzAgent. 


Mythic Olive Nourishing lotion:


This Body lotion is amazing. It smells like vanilla, but is not too over the top so it wouldn't affect any perfumes you put on over the top. It absorbs quickly into the skin and after using for a while it has left my skin feeling a lot softer and more nourished.

To use you simply squeeze a plump or two into your hands and then massage it into any dry areas, and it instantly soothes and softens them. I have even taken to using this lotion daily on my hands, and I have noticed that they are feeling a lot softer than they were! 

However, due to the shape of the bottle I do fund that it can be hard to pump the product out, especially if I have already massaged some in. Though for £5.99 I think this is a great body lotion and you can buy it here: Mythic Olive lotion - £5.99.


Mythic Olive Nourishing oil:


Sometimes moisturising can seem like a long and boring task and this is when I like to use a body oil, as the spray on application makes things 10 times quicker and the product usually sinks in quicker too. 

Again this oil has a soft vanilla scent to it and does leave my skin feeling soft, though it does also leave me feeling slightly greasy for a while but it's nothing too uncomfortable. However, it does have the same problem with the bottle design so I would recommend spraying it all over before rubbing it in.

This body oil costs £7.99 and I'm not sure if I would repurchase, but at Superdrug you can purchase these two items for buy one get one half half price, so if you want to try them now is a good time! You can buy it here: Mythic Olive oil - £7.99.
